To find an equation equivalent to \( w = x + y - z \), let's rearrange it to solve for \( z \):
Starting with: \[ w = x + y - z \]
We can add \( z \) to both sides: \[ w + z = x + y \]
Next, we can isolate \( z \) by subtracting \( w \) from both sides: \[ z = x + y - w \]
So the equation equivalent to \( w = x + y - z \) is: \[ z = x + y - w \]
